"There are few efficiency considerations when putting big data into nodes (accurately property). Search filtering may become slower due to search scope and size increases. Changes may result in overhead such as wal log. Although it's difficult to determine how much big data you have, but I think you should save it as a file and save its description as property type. Information saved in the property can reduce access expense by the creation of a seperate property index. "
